We are seeking a reliable, professional, and compassionate Front Desk Administrative Staff Member to support daily operations at our outpatient mental health clinic. This role is critical in creating a welcoming environment for patients while ensuring efficient front-office operations. The ideal candidate will have prior experience working with a TMS (Transcranial Magnetic Stimulation) machine and supporting TMS treatment workflows.
Key Responsibilities
Front Desk & Administrative Duties
Greet patients warmly and professionally upon arrival Manage patient check-in and check-out processes Answer incoming phone calls, route messages, and respond to inquiries appropriately Schedule, confirm, and manage appointments for therapy, psychiatry, and TMS services Maintain accurate patient records in the electronic health record (EHR) system Collect copays, verify insurance information, and assist with basic billing-related questions Ensure front desk area remains organized, professional, and HIPAA-compliant Coordinate communication between providers, clinical staff, and patients
TMS-Specific Responsibilities
Operate and assist with TMS machine setup and treatment sessions, as directed by clinical staff Prepare patients for TMS sessions and provide procedural explanations within scope Ensure proper documentation of TMS sessions and treatment schedules Monitor equipment readiness and report any issues or maintenance needs Adhere to all clinic protocols, safety procedures, and manufacturer guidelines related to TMS
Required Qualifications
High school diploma or equivalent (required) Prior experience with TMS machines and TMS treatment workflows (required) Experience in a healthcare, mental health, or medical office setting Strong interpersonal and customer service skills Professional demeanor with sensitivity to mental health populations Excellent organizational and multitasking abilities Basic proficiency with computers, scheduling systems, and EHR platforms Understanding of HIPAA and patient confidentiality standards
